British Prime Minister Keir Starmer triggered a significant internal leadership crisis this week in London following his controversial decision to appoint Lord Peter Mandelson as the United Kingdom’s ambassador to the United States. The political firestorm erupted as Members of Parliament and the public scrutinized Mandelson’s historical ties to the late conv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epstein, a connection that critics argue undermines the integrity of one of Britain's most critical diplomatic postings. This move has placed Starmer under intense pressure from both opposition parties and his own backbenchers, who fear the appointment could damage the UK's special relationship with Washington. The backlash centers on the long-standing association between Lord Mandelson, a central architect of the New Labour movement, and Epstein, who died in a luxury Manhattan jail cell in 2019 while awaiting trial on sex trafficking charges. Reports have long detailed Mandelson’s visits to Epstein’s properties, raising ethical concerns that have now bubbled over into a full-blown political liability for the nascent Starmer administration. By choosing such a polarizing figure for the plum role in the U.S. capital, Starmer is accused of prioritizing political patronage over the stringent vetting standards expected for high-ranking diplomatic roles. Downing Street officials have reportedly been scramble to contain the fallout as calls for a reconsideration of the appointment grow louder. Strategic advisors warn that the optics of the appointment are particularly damaging given the current global focus on accountability and the protection of victims of sexual abuse. Furthermore, there are concerns that Mandelson’s presence in Washington could prove a distraction during high-stakes negotiations regarding trade and defense, as the American media and political establishment may fixate on his controversial past rather than bilateral policy. This crisis marks the most precarious moment for Starmer since taking office, testing his ability to maintain party discipline and public trust. While the Prime Minister has historically valued Mandelson’s strategic expertise, the sheer volume of disapproval suggests that the political cost of this appointment may outweigh its perceived benefits. As the government attempts to navigate this diplomatic minefield, the controversy remains a primary focus of British political discourse, highlighting the deep-seated tensions between the party's old guard and its current leadership requirements.
